  • Columbia Land Trust is excited to welcome Birdhers for a morning of learning and birdwatching at Frenchman’s Bar Regional Park. We’ll be observing sandhill cranes and sharing the work that Columbia Land Trust is doing to support this threatened species locally. Our presentation begins at 8:00am but guests are welcome to arrive earlier to catch more crane sightings, which are often most visible at dawn.

    When: Saturday, November 22nd, 2025; 8:00am - 9:30am

    Where: Frenchman's Bar Regional Park at 9612 NW Lower River Rd, Vancouver, WA

    What to Expect: 
    This will be an informational visit with about a half hour of storytelling and Q&A, followed by the chance to explore Frenchman's Bar for further birdwatching opportunities. Participants are also welcome to move on to a second nearby location, Blurock Landing on NW Lower River Road, which features additional walking trails and viewing opportunities.

    Our location at Frenchman's Bar features a covered picnic shelter as well as ADA accessible paths and restrooms. Parking costs $3 at the entrance which is payable by card at the kiosk entrance. To find our group, please keep to the left after entering the parking area and head to the furthest picnic shelter where we will gather.

    Please dress warmly, pack your rain gear, and bring a pair of binoculars if you have them. We will provide hot tea, spotting scopes, and a few binoculars to share.
